当前位置:首页 / EXCEL

如何在CAD中修改Excel数据?如何实现数据同步更新?

作者:佚名|分类:EXCEL|浏览:101|发布时间:2025-03-14 10:48:05

如何在CAD中修改Excel数据?如何实现数据同步更新?

随着计算机技术的不断发展,CAD(计算机辅助设计)和Excel(电子表格软件)在工程设计、数据处理等领域得到了广泛应用。在实际工作中,我们常常需要将CAD中的数据与Excel进行交互,以便于数据的修改和同步更新。本文将详细介绍如何在CAD中修改Excel数据,以及如何实现数据同步更新。

一、CAD中修改Excel数据的方法

1. 使用外部参照功能

(1)打开CAD文件,选择“插入”菜单中的“外部参照”选项。

(2)在弹出的对话框中,选择“Excel文件”作为参照类型,然后点击“浏览”按钮,找到需要修改的Excel文件。

(3)点击“确定”按钮,将Excel文件作为外部参照插入到CAD中。

(4)在CAD中,选中插入的Excel文件,右键点击选择“打开外部参照”。

(5)在打开的Excel文件中修改数据,然后关闭Excel文件。

(6)在CAD中,再次选中插入的Excel文件,右键点击选择“更新外部参照”。

(7)CAD中的数据将根据修改后的Excel数据进行更新。

2. 使用数据链接功能

(1)打开CAD文件,选择“插入”菜单中的“数据链接”选项。

(2)在弹出的对话框中,选择“Excel文件”作为数据链接类型,然后点击“浏览”按钮,找到需要修改的Excel文件。

(3)点击“确定”按钮,将Excel文件作为数据链接插入到CAD中。

(4)在CAD中,选中插入的数据链接,右键点击选择“编辑数据链接”。

(5)在弹出的对话框中,选择“更新链接”选项,然后点击“确定”按钮。

(6)CAD中的数据将根据修改后的Excel数据进行更新。

二、实现数据同步更新的方法

1. 使用VBA编程

(1)打开Excel文件,选择“开发工具”菜单中的“Visual Basic”选项。

(2)在打开的VBA编辑器中,插入一个新的模块。

(3)在模块中编写以下代码:

Sub UpdateCADData()

Dim CADApp As Object

Set CADApp = CreateObject("AutoCAD.Application")

CADApp.Visible = True

CADApp.Document.Open("C:\path\to\your\CAD\file.dwg")

' 在此处添加修改CAD数据的代码

CADApp.Document.Close

Set CADApp = Nothing

End Sub

(4)将代码保存并关闭VBA编辑器。

(5)在Excel中,创建一个按钮或运行宏,用于调用VBA代码,实现数据同步更新。

2. 使用第三方插件

市面上有许多第三方插件可以实现CAD与Excel的数据同步更新,如AutoCAD Data Link、CAD Excel Link等。这些插件通常具有以下功能:

(1)支持多种CAD和Excel文件格式。

(2)提供可视化界面,方便用户操作。

(3)支持数据双向同步。

(4)支持定时任务,自动更新数据。

三、相关问答

1. 如何在CAD中修改Excel数据?

答:在CAD中,可以通过以下方法修改Excel数据:

(1)使用外部参照功能。

(2)使用数据链接功能。

2. 如何实现数据同步更新?

答:实现数据同步更新的方法有:

(1)使用VBA编程。

(2)使用第三方插件。

3. 如何在VBA中修改CAD数据?

答:在VBA中,可以通过以下步骤修改CAD数据:

(1)创建一个AutoCAD应用程序对象。

(2)打开CAD文件。

(3)在CAD文件中修改数据。

(4)关闭CAD文件。

(5)释放AutoCAD应用程序对象。

4. 如何选择合适的第三方插件?

答:选择合适的第三方插件需要考虑以下因素:

(1)兼容性:插件是否支持您的CAD和Excel版本。

(2)功能:插件是否满足您的需求。

(3)易用性:插件的界面是否友好,操作是否简便。

(4)价格:插件的价格是否合理。

在CAD中修改Excel数据并实现数据同步更新,可以通过多种方法实现。选择合适的方法,可以提高工作效率,降低工作难度。